Package: xscreensaver
Version: 5.05-3
Severity: important
If you are switched to a virtual terminal e.g. ctrl-alt-f1 then the X
session does not lock.
The old behaviour in etch: when you switched back to the X session
ctrl-alt-f7 the screen would momentarily display the old screen before
the screensaver appeared and the password dialog popped up. (assuming
you had been switched away for long enough)
In lenny there is no locking at all, you can switch to ctrl-alt-f1 for
arbitrary lengths of time and when you switch back ctrl-alt-f7 the
screen is not locked.
(IMO, even the old behaviour with etch was a minor problem, if you were
quick with a camera you could grab a snapshot of what was on the screen.
But the current behaviour is a serious bug.)
I've reproduced this problem on two different systems:
